At the very top of the Rhône valley, Goms, Conches in French, brings together the high-valley villages between mountain pastures and the sources of the river.
The villages of Münster, Reckingen and Niederwald keep a remarkable heritage of sun-browned wooden houses and baroque churches, in a high valley renowned for cross-country skiing and hiking. The preserved alpine setting defines the identity of the place.
The market mixes year-round residents and second homes won over by the authenticity and the quiet. Chalets of character and traditional houses lead a market at measured prices.
Over the past 25 years, the price per square metre of a flat in Goms has gone from around CHF 2 900 to CHF 7 300, a change of +152 %. Over the last twelve months, the trend is +7,4 %.
These figures track the local market over time. They point to a trend, they do not replace the valuation of a specific property, which depends on its condition, its floor and its view.

The median price of a house in Goms is around CHF 6 100 per m² of living space. The plot, the orientation and the year of construction then move that figure noticeably.
